The property is situated on 36.25 acres of land, offering plenty of space and privacy. It’s surrounded by thousands of acres of Bureau of Land Management (BLM) land, providing a vast expanse of untouched natural beauty. You’ll find yourself enjoying the stunning valley views from the wrap-around porch from morning to evening. The property’s elevation is just under 6000 feet. The property boasts a 28’x40’ barn with two horse stalls, two corrals, and a fenced-in pasture area. The home itself is a 2-bedroom, 2-bathroom dwelling built in 2018 by a reputable local builder. The North Fork of the Gunnison flows through a corner of the property, adding a tranquil and picturesque element to the landscape. The septic system and well were both installed in 2018. The well’s capacity allows for three households and one acre of irrigation. The property comes with the tractor and implements, refrigerator, dishwasher, oven/range, washer, and dryer. There’s a small cabin located on the southeast side of the property that’s well-insulated and was previously used off-grid. This could potentially serve as a guest cabin or artist studio.
